Why did Haikang Life change its name to Tongfang Life?

Frequent changes in equity and executives. China Offshore Oil Investment Holding Company, the Chinese shareholder of Haikang Life Insurance, transferred 50% of its shares in Haikang Life Insurance to Tongfang, and the CIRC approved the transfer. Under the frequent changes of shares and executives, Haikang Life Insurance has officially changed its name to Tongfang Global Life Insurance, which was officially renamed six months after Haikang Life Insurance introduced a new China shareholder, Tsinghua Tongfang. Tongfang Universal Life Insurance Co., Ltd. (formerly Haikang Life Insurance Co., Ltd.) was established by Dutch Universal Life Insurance Group (Aegon) and Tongfang Limited (THTF) with 50% capital contribution respectively. In May 2003, the company officially obtained the business license to conduct life insurance business in China.
